When is the Hunter's Moon in 2026?
The Hunter's Moon 2026 reaches fullness on October 26 at 12:12 AM Eastern Time, which is late on October 25 in the Pacific time zone and the small hours of October 26 for the East Coast and Europe. It is the full moon that follows the Harvest Moon, and it takes its name from the old hunting season, when the bright autumn moon lit the fields for gathering game before winter.
This year the Hunter's Moon is the last full moon before Halloween, and notably it is eclipse-free, unlike the eclipse-heavy moons of late summer 2026. That makes it a clean, steady full moon rather than a charged one. It rises, however, during the double retrograde of Venus and Mercury in Scorpio, which is exactly why its grounding quality is so welcome.

Why is it called the Hunter's Moon?
The Hunter's Moon is the traditional name for the full moon after the Harvest Moon, usually falling in October. With the crops gathered and the animals fattened, it was the moon under which hunters stocked up for winter, aided by its early, bright rising. Like other moon names, it is seasonal folklore rather than astrology, though it pairs beautifully with grounded, practical Taurus.
Is the Hunter's Moon a supermoon in 2026?
No. The 2026 Hunter's Moon is a standard full moon, not a supermoon; the year's headline supermoons are the Beaver Moon in November and the Cold Moon in December. What makes this Hunter's Moon notable is not size but timing: it is the steady, eclipse-free full moon that lands right before Halloween and right in the middle of the Scorpio double retrograde.
